Output 31e51a3b5d46dfe97b31709531b67e8c703433fc071dd39f81b61da5f3cd2697:0

value
2493020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64405e4bfde23cf927d2a9ed2529421184831542 OP_EQUAL
address
3Aq6c7o3zyzzeRbAdyBw5h8Se4TWoRxJJU
transaction
31e51a3b5d46dfe97b31709531b67e8c703433fc071dd39f81b61da5f3cd2697
spent
true